Analysis

Mexico recorded 77.9% for proportion of youth and adults that participated in social networks in 2023. That is the highest value across all 11 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 6.0% on the previous year and up 621.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, proportion of youth and adults that participated in social networks in Mexico peaked at 77.9% in 2023 and was at its lowest, 10.8%, in 2013.

That places Mexico 10th out of 56 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 11 years of available data.

Proportion of youth and adults that participated in social networks in Mexico, year by year

Annual values for Proportion of youth and adults that participated in social networks, 25-74 years old, both sexes (%) in Mexico, 2013 to 2023.
Year % Change
2013 10.8%
2014 13.5% +25.0%
2015 34.7% +157.0%
2016 40.1% +15.6%
2017 36.5% -9.0%
2018 51.5% +41.1%
2019 63.4% +23.1%
2020 64.2% +1.3%
2021 69.2% +7.8%
2022 73.5% +6.2%
2023 77.9% +6.0%
